มาทำความรู้จักกับ HTTP: หัวใจของการท่องเว็บไซต์! 🌐

เคยสงสัยไหมว่าเวลาเราเข้าเว็บไซต์ ข้อมูลมันเดินทางไปมาหากันได้ยังไง? คำตอบก็คือ HTTP (Hypertext Transfer Protocol) นั่นเอง! มาดูกันว่าโปรโตคอลพื้นฐานนี้ทำงานยังไงบ้าง

HTTP คืออะไร?

เปรียบง่ายๆ HTTP ก็เหมือนเป็น "ภาษา" ที่ใช้คุยกันระหว่าง เว็บเบราว์เซอร์ ของเรา (Client) กับ เว็บเซิร์ฟเวอร์ (Server) เมื่อเราพิมพ์ URL บนเบราว์เซอร์ นั่นคือการส่ง "คำขอ" (Request) ไปยังเซิร์ฟเวอร์ และเซิร์ฟเวอร์ก็จะส่ง "การตอบสนอง" (Response) กลับมาพร้อมกับข้อมูลที่เราต้องการ

โครงสร้างการสื่อสารของ HTTP

การสื่อสารของ HTTP จะประกอบด้วย 3 ส่วนหลักๆ:

Request Line / Status Line: บรรทัดแรกที่บอกว่า "กำลังทำอะไร" (สำหรับคำขอ) หรือ "ผลลัพธ์เป็นยังไง" (สำหรับการตอบสนอง)

Headers: ข้อมูลเพิ่มเติมที่จำเป็นสำหรับการสื่อสาร เช่น ประเภทของข้อมูลที่ส่ง, เว็บไซต์ที่เข้าชม หรือเบราว์เซอร์ที่ใช้

Body: ข้อมูลจริงๆ ที่ส่งหรือรับ เช่น ไฟล์ HTML, รูปภาพ หรือข้อความ

ตัวอย่างการทำงานง่ายๆ:

เราพิมพ์ www.example.com ในช่อง URL ➡️ เบราว์เซอร์ส่ง HTTP Request ไปหาเซิร์ฟเวอร์

เซิร์ฟเวอร์ค้นหาข้อมูล ➡️ แล้วส่ง HTTP Response กลับมา

เบราว์เซอร์แสดงหน้าเว็บ www.example.com ให้เราเห็น

HTTP Methods: คำสั่งที่เราใช้คุยกับเซิร์ฟเวอร์

คำสั่งเหล่านี้จะบอกเซิร์ฟเวอร์ว่าเราต้องการทำอะไรกับข้อมูลในเว็บไซต์:

GET: ดึงข้อมูล (เช่น อ่านโพสต์)

POST: ส่งข้อมูลเพื่อสร้างของใหม่ (เช่น สมัครสมาชิก, โพสต์ข้อความ)

PUT/PATCH: แก้ไขข้อมูลที่มีอยู่

DELETE: ลบข้อมูล

HTTP Status Codes: ผลลัพธ์ของการสื่อสาร

เซิร์ฟเวอร์จะส่งรหัสตัวเลข 3 หลักกลับมา เพื่อบอกสถานะของคำขอ:

2xx (สำเร็จ): 200 OK ✅ คำขอสำเร็จด้วยดี

3xx (Redirect): 301 Moved Permanently ➡️ ข้อมูลถูกย้ายไปที่อื่น

4xx (ฝั่งเราผิด): 404 Not Found 🚫 หาหน้าที่คุณต้องการไม่เจอ

5xx (ฝั่งเซิร์ฟเวอร์ผิด): 500 Internal Server Error 💀 เซิร์ฟเวอร์มีปัญหา

สรุป

การทำความเข้าใจ HTTP เป็นพื้นฐานสำคัญสำหรับทุกคนที่ทำงานเกี่ยวข้องกับการพัฒนาเว็บไซต์ เพราะมันจะช่วยให้เราเข้าใจการทำงานของระบบได้อย่างแท้จริงและแก้ไขปัญหาได้ตรงจุดมากขึ้น

#ติดเทรนด์ #Lemon8ฮาวทู #lemon8ไดอารี่ #software #เทคโนโลยี

2025/8/6 แก้ไขเป็น

... อ่านเพิ่มเติมHTTP (Hypertext Transfer Protocol) คือพื้นฐานสำคัญของการสื่อสารบนอินเทอร์เน็ตที่ช่วยให้เว็บเบราว์เซอร์และเซิร์ฟเวอร์สามารถแลกเปลี่ยนข้อมูลกันได้อย่างราบรื่น HTTP ทำหน้าที่เป็นภาษากลางในการส่งคำขอและรับข้อมูลที่ต้องการผ่าน URL ซึ่งเมื่อผู้ใช้พิมพ์เว็บไซต์ลงไป เบราว์เซอร์จะส่ง HTTP Request ไปยังเซิร์ฟเวอร์ จากนั้นเซิร์ฟเวอร์จะส่ง HTTP Response กลับมา ซึ่งประกอบด้วยข้อมูลที่เบราว์เซอร์นำมาแสดงผลบนหน้าจอ นอกจากโครงสร้างหลักของ HTTP ที่ประกอบด้วย Request Line, Headers และ Body แล้ว ยังมี HTTP Methods ที่เป็นชุดคำสั่งบอกให้เซิร์ฟเวอร์รู้ว่าเราต้องการทำอะไร เช่น GET สำหรับดึงข้อมูล, POST สำหรับส่งข้อมูลใหม่, PUT/PATCH สำหรับแก้ไขข้อมูล และ DELETE สำหรับลบข้อมูล การเข้าใจคำสั่งเหล่านี้เป็นสิ่งจำเป็นสำหรับนักพัฒนาเว็บไซต์เพื่อจัดการข้อมูลอย่างถูกต้องและปลอดภัย อีกหนึ่งองค์ประกอบสำคัญคือ HTTP Status Codes ซึ่งเป็นตัวบ่งชี้สถานะของคำขอ เช่น 200 OK คือสำเร็จ, 301 Redirect คือย้ายถาวร, 404 Not Found หมายถึงหน้าเว็บไม่พบ และ 500 Internal Server Error ที่แสดงว่าเกิดข้อผิดพลาดจากเซิร์ฟเวอร์ ความรู้ในส่วนนี้ช่วยให้ผู้ดูแลเว็บไซต์และนักพัฒนาสามารถวิเคราะห์ปัญหาและแก้ไขได้ตรงจุด นอกจากนี้ เทคโนโลยี HTTP ยังพัฒนาไปสู่เวอร์ชันใหม่ ๆ อย่าง HTTP/2 และ HTTP/3 ที่เพิ่มประสิทธิภาพการส่งข้อมูลให้รวดเร็วและปลอดภัยมากขึ้น รวมถึงการใช้งานร่วมกับ HTTPS ที่เพิ่มการเข้ารหัสข้อมูลเพื่อความปลอดภัยของผู้ใช้ การมีความเข้าใจลึกซึ้งเกี่ยวกับโปรโตคอล HTTP และการอัพเดตเทคโนโลยีที่เกี่ยวข้องจึงเป็นสิ่งจำเป็นสำหรับทุกคนที่ทำงานเกี่ยวกับเว็บไซต์และการพัฒนาแอปพลิเคชันเว็บ ด้วยความรู้เหล่านี้ ผู้ใช้งานทั่วไปจะสามารถเข้าใจเบื้องหลังการทำงานของเว็บไซต์ได้ดีขึ้น และนักพัฒนาเว็บไซต์ทุกคนจะสามารถปรับปรุงและแก้ไขปัญหาในระบบของตนให้มีประสิทธิภาพและตอบสนองความต้องการของผู้ใช้ได้อย่างครบถ้วน

โพสต์ที่เกี่ยวข้อง

ภาพแสดงรายชื่อมหาวิทยาลัยชั้นนำพร้อมลิงก์เว็บไซต์รับสมัครสำหรับ #DEK69 ช่วยให้นักเรียนติดตามข้อมูลการสมัคร TCAS69 ได้อย่างครบถ้วนและสะดวกสบาย จัดทำโดย @Dolphincamp_Education.
💻เว็บไซต์! การรับสมัครของทุกมหาวิทยาลัย
🎓🌟Dek69 พร้อมกันหรือยัง?🌟🎓 💻 พี่ Dolphin รวบรวมมาให้แล้ว! เว็บไซต์ติดตามการรับสมัครของทุกมหาวิทยาลัยชั้นนำ ไม่ว่าจะเป็น 🏢 จุฬาฯ | ม.เกษตร | มข. | มช. | มธ. | มหิดล | ศิลปากร | มศว | ม.อ. | ลาดกระบัง และ อีกเพียบ!🔥 ✨เพียงคลิกลิงก็ตามมหาลัยที่สนใจ ก็สามารถเช็กวันสมัคร รอบรับ และเงื่อนไขได้แบ
Dolphincamp

Dolphincamp

ถูกใจ 27 ครั้ง

ภาพแสดงรายชื่อและลิงก์เว็บไซต์รับสมัครของมหาวิทยาลัยต่างๆ สำหรับ dek69 เช่น จุฬาลงกรณ์มหาวิทยาลัย มหาวิทยาลัยเกษตรศาสตร์ และมหาวิทยาลัยธรรมศาสตร์ จัดทำโดย Dolphincamp Education เพื่อให้นักเรียนติดตามข้อมูลการรับสมัครได้ง่าย
💻📌 WEBSITE สำหรับ dek69 รวมช่องทางติดตามการรับสมัครของแต่ละมหาวิทยาลัย
💻📌 WEBSITE สำหรับ dek69 รวมช่องทางติดตามการรับสมัครของแต่ละมหาวิทยาลัย ไว้ให้ครบในโพสต์เดียว! 🎓✨ 🔍 ไม่ต้องเสียเวลาหาเอง พี่ Dolphin รวมลิงก์เว็บไซต์ทางการของมหาวิทยาลัยดัง สามารถเช็กกำหนดการเปิด–ปิดรับสมัครได้แบบชัดเจน 📆📚 📥 แนะนำให้กดเซฟโพสต์นี้ไว้ หรือส่งต่อให้เพื่อนๆ ในกลุ่มอ่าน จะได้ไม่
Dolphincamp

Dolphincamp

ถูกใจ 10 ครั้ง

แชร์การทำ นับวันเวลาถอยหลัง 🕝⏳
เราจะมาแชร์วิธีการทำ นับเวลาถอยหลัง ในส่วนตัวที่เราทำเวลานับถอยหลังให้มีอยู่ใน #การ์ดแต่งงานออนไลน์ ของเรา เพราะว่าเราอยากให้มันดูมีอะไรมากขึ้น แค่นั้นเอง แหะๆ 😆😆 เราเลยเอามาแชร์วิธีการทำให้เพื่อนๆ เผื่อใครสนใจที่จะลองทำเองดู ทำเองทั้งหมด ดูจาก refferend ของเพื่อนๆคนอื่นที่เขามีแล้วมาปรับใช
Med ρloy 🐳

Med ρloy 🐳

ถูกใจ 79 ครั้ง

ปิด 4 จุดเสี่ยงโดนดึงข้อมูลส่วนตัวและพิกัดตอนค้นหาเว็บ ทำตามนี้ปลอดภัยและไม่มีใครตามรอยได้แน่นอนครับ
ปิด 4 จุดเสี่ยงโดนดึงข้อมูลส่วนตัวและพิกัดตอนค้นหาเว็บ ทำตามนี้ปลอดภัยและไม่มีใครตามรอยได้แน่นอนครับ #ไอทีเล่ามือถือบอก2 #ความปลอดภัยมือถือ #สอนใช้มือถือ #ทริคไอโฟน #แอบติดตาม
ไอทีเล่ามือถือบอก

ไอทีเล่ามือถือบอก

ถูกใจ 5 ครั้ง

“100 คำศัพท์ธุรกิจที่คนทำงานต้องรู้! ใช้จริงในบริษัท 🇰🇷✔️
“100 คำศัพท์ธุรกิจที่คนทำงานต้องรู้! ใช้จริงในบริษัท 🇰🇷✔️ เตรียมสอบ TOPIK ก็ได้ ใช้ในงานจริงก็ปัง เก็บโพสต์นี้ไว้ท่องทุกวัน มีประโยชน์มาก ❤️” . . . . . . . . . . . . . . . . . . . . . . . . . . . 📩 สอบถามคอร์ส & สั่งซื้อชีทสรุป : ทักแชทได้ที่ 💬 Inbox: http://m.me/107806144252161 💚 LINE: k
KoreanHome บ้านภาษาเกาหลี.bua

KoreanHome บ้านภาษาเกาหลี.bua

ถูกใจ 1 ครั้ง

ปิดด่วนก่อนท่องเว็บ! ป้องกันโดนดูดข้อมูล (iPhone)✨🍋✅
⚠️ เตือนภัยคนใช้ iPhone! ปิดจุดเสี่ยงมิจฉาชีพด่วนนน ทำตามคลิปนี้ ข้อมูลไม่รั่วแน่นอน! ดูจบแล้วอย่าลืมแชร์บอกต่อเพื่อนด้วยนะ ✅📱 #ป้องกันมิจฉาชีพทางโทรศัพท์ #แก้ปัญหาไอโฟน #เตือนภัย #Lemon8ฮาวทู #พี่กุ๋ยไอทีสเตชั่น
พี่กุ๋ยไอทีสเตชั่น

พี่กุ๋ยไอทีสเตชั่น

ถูกใจ 8 ครั้ง

ภาพหญิงสาวในชุดลูกเรือสีแดงเลือดหมูของสายการบินกาตาร์แอร์เวย์สกำลังยิ้มสดใส พร้อมเพื่อนร่วมงานที่อยู่ด้านหลัง มีข้อความว่า "ทำแบบนี้... เพิ่มโอกาสติดปีก 80%" ซึ่งสอดคล้องกับเนื้อหาบทความเกี่ยวกับการเตรียมตัวเป็นลูกเรือ.
🛫 ทำแบบนี้โอกาส “ติดปีก” เพิ่มขึ้น 80%
สวัสดีน้องๆ นะคะ 🤍 โพสต์นี้พี่อยากให้เป็นเหมือน “แผนที่ก่อนออกเดินทาง” สำหรับน้องที่อยากติดปีกจริง ไม่อยากสมัครมั่วๆ หลายคนไม่ได้ไม่เก่ง แต่แค่ ยังไม่รู้ว่าจะเริ่มตรงไหนก่อน ถ้าทำ 5 ข้อนี้ โอกาสติดปีกจะต่างทันทีค่ะ 👇 ⸻ 1️⃣ หาข้อมูลชีวิตและอาชีพลูกเรือให้ ‘ครอบคลุมทุกด้าน’ น้องหลายคน
พี่จุ๋ม Ex-Purser กาตาร์

พี่จุ๋ม Ex-Purser กาตาร์

ถูกใจ 436 ครั้ง

หน้าจอแสดงระบบเว็บไซต์สำหรับทำเนียบผู้ผ่านการอบรมฯ ที่สร้างด้วย Canva AI และเชื่อมต่อกับ Google Sheet มีช่องค้นหา กรองข้อมูล และตารางแสดงข้อมูลผู้เข้าอบรม
หน้าจอแสดงภาพรวมข้อมูลผู้เข้าอบรมทั้งหมด 899 คน จาก 23 จังหวัด 12 เขตตรวจราชการ และ 689 สถานศึกษา พร้อมช่องค้นหาและตัวกรองข้อมูล
ส่วนหนึ่งของหน้าจอแสดงสรุปข้อมูลผู้เข้าอบรมแยกตามเขตตรวจราชการ โดยมีจำนวนผู้เข้าอบรมในแต่ละเขตแสดงอยู่
Promtระบบเว็บไซต์ด้วย Canva AI เชื่อมข้อมูล Google sheet
🍋 สร้างเว็บไซต์ง่ายๆ ไม่ต้องเขียนโค้ด! ด้วย Canva AI & Google Sheet ✨ เบื่อไหมกับการสร้างระบบเว็บไซต์ที่ต้องเสียเวลาเขียนโค้ด? 😩 วันนี้มาแชร์ทางลัดสุดปัง! ที่ช่วยให้คุณมี เว็บแอป ส่วนตัวได้ง่าย ๆ แถมไม่ต้องแตะโค้ดเลย! 💻 💡 ขั้นตอนง่าย ๆ ที่ใครก็ทำได้: ออกแบบใน Canva: ใช้ Canva AI ช่วยออกแบบ
vxxwpc._

vxxwpc._

ถูกใจ 6 ครั้ง

ดูเพิ่มเติม